Cooperative Agreement Makes $6.2 Million Available for Rapid Acceleration of Diagnostics-Radical Data Coordination Center (10)
WASHINGTON, Aug. 6 -- The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services' National Institutes of Health announced that it expects to award a cooperative agreement for a rapid acceleration of diagnostics-radical data coordination center. The estimated total program funding available was cited as $6.2 million with a ceiling of $4 million. Cooperative Agreements Make $10 Million Available for Automatic Detection, Tracing of Coronavirus (10)
WASHINGTON, Aug. 7 -- The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services' National Institutes of Health announced that it expects to award up to 10 cooperative agreements for automatic detection and tracing of coronavirus. The estimated total program funding available was cited as $10 million with a ceiling of $300,000. Cooperative Agreements Make $10 Million Available for Screening for COVID-19 by Electronic-Nose Technology (10)
WASHINGTON, Aug. 6 -- The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services' National Institutes of Health announced that it expects to award up to five cooperative agreements for screening for COVID-19 by electronic-nose technology. The estimated total program funding available was cited as $10 million. The categories of funding activity are a) education, b) health, and c) income security and social services. Cooperative Agreements Make $5 Million Available for Research to Predict COVID-19 Associated Inflammatory Disease Severity in Children (10)
WASHINGTON, Aug. 6 -- The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services' National Institutes of Health announced that it expects to award up to five grants for research to predict COVID-19 associated inflammatory disease severity in children. The estimated total program funding available was cited as $5 million with a ceiling of $500,000. Cooperative Agreements Make $7 Million Available for Chemosensory Testing as COVID-19 Screening Tool (10)
WASHINGTON, Aug. 7 -- The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services' National Institutes of Health announced that it expects to award cooperative agreements for chemosensory testing as COVID-19 screening tool. The estimated total program funding available was cited as $7 million with a ceiling of $500,000.
